Why Is N-Acetyl Cysteine (NAC) Good For Emphysema Disease? N-acetyl cysteine (NAC) is good for emphysema disease. It is not only the anti-mucus properties of n-acetyl cysteine (NAC) which can help to alleviate the symptoms associated with emphysema disease, but n-acetyl cysteine (NAC) can also act as an antioxidant and protect against lung tissue damage.

How Much N-Acetyl Cysteine (NAC) Should You Take For Emphysema Disease? Bronchitis- introduction Bronchitis is an acute inflammation of the air passages within the lungs. It occurs when the trachea (windpipe) and the large and small bronchi (airways) within the lungs become inflamed because of infection or other causes. The thin mucous lining of these airways can become irritated and swollen. The cells that make up this lining may leak fluids in response...


Chronic bronchitis is the inflammation or swelling of the air passageways (bronchi) in the upper respiratory system. This is usually accompanied by the excessive production of mucus. Chronic bronchitis can manifest as many different symptoms, and is often hard to diagnose because the symptoms are so similar to other diseases that affect the lungs and respiratory system. Chronic bronchitis is a very common respiratory disease that involves inflammation and infection of the bronchial tubes, mucosal membranes and tissues. The disease is manifested by an overproduction of mucus that results in temporary obstruction of the airways. In the first stages of chronic bronchitis, the disease only affects the major airways, generating milder and less persistent symptoms....
